Match Summary

Netherlands and United States of America met in Match 111 of ICC CWC League 2 , and the contest unfolded as a tactical battle rather than a straightforward run chase. Netherlands posted 196/8 (50). United States of America posted 175/10 (47.5). Max O'Dowd led the batting charts with 59 from 111 balls, blending risk control with timely acceleration. Harmeet Singh delivered the standout spell, finishing with 4 wickets while conceding only 26 runs.
